Transaction bab8a6cc5367321b4f43106e592c86ba787cf4105696a9e5ff976572a7289f49
1 Input
1 Output
-
bab8a6cc5367321b4f43106e592c86ba787cf4105696a9e5ff976572a7289f49:0
- value
- 137424263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24892fd1ae1f981e8665db7ec4f08b6f4c376e70 OP_EQUAL
- address
- MBELuExw4TEUzFkMF2oM1w3YZerHq13YBb